A Poets Love
written by nicole_lyndon
09:29 AM 2/15/05
My mind races when i think of you.
I have sat here for hours,
thinking about you, but can't write.
There is so much about you
that I get tangled on my own words.
Just one word.....
there can't possibly be enough words
for me to express the uter joy I feel
when I am with you.
My stomach, so sick with love
flipping round and round.
I can't erase you from my thoughts.
I can't....
breath without the sweetness of your kiss
creeping up and seducing my lips.
I need you and want you!
You know who you are.
Rescue me and love me back!
